
The Curtis Parent Organization (CPO) is a nonprofit organization, run by volunteers, comprised of parents and guardians of Ephraim Curtis Middle School students.
Our mission is to support the school with volunteers and funding for events and activities, enrichment programs, scholarships, and items for the teachers, staff, and administration that will enrich students’ experiences.
Our primary goals are to:
- Provide scholarships for students
- Offer cultural and creative enrichment programs
- Fund items not covered in the SPS budget
- Thank the teachers, staff, and administration with appreciation events
- Foster a sense of community within our school
